USE
• Connect the plug to the socket-contact. The LCD display shows OFF.
• Turn on the curling tongs by pressing the power switch.
• The display shows a temperature of 180°C. You can set the temperature from 100°C
to 210°C with the + or - buttons. The temperature is set in steps of 10°C.
• The appropriate temperature depends on your hair structure.
• Fine, porous, dyed or bleached hair: 100°C-160°C.
• Normal hair: 160°C-200°C.
• Strong, curly, hardy hair: 200°C-210°C.
• Remember that when you use the highest temperature, you must not treat the same
strand of hair more than once. Otherwise the hair can be damaged.
• If you press the + or - buttons for more than 2 seconds, the temperature setting is
locked. The LCD display shows LOC. This is a practical feature to lock the temperature
if the curling tongs are used for long periods.
• To lock the temperature setting, press + or - and keep the button pressed in until the
LCD display ceases to show LOC.
• If the curling tongs are turned on and are not used within an hour, they turn off
automatically. The LCD display shows SLP. Press the power switch if you want to use
the curling tongs again.
• Never leave the plug in the socket-outlet when the curling tongs are not in use.
• Always use the curling tongs on dry hair.
• Let the curling tongs cool down completely before you place them in storage.
• The straightener should be stored out of reach of children.
TIPS
SOFT CURLS
Roll a 5 cm wide strand of hair from the tip to the roots on the tongs and close the clamp.
Keep the strand of hair in position for a maximum of 10 seconds. Do not pull the curling
tongs when you unwind the strand of hair, otherwise the curl will straighten out.
